BURLINGTON, NJ – Arsenault Associates, a provider in Dossier fleet maintenance software and solutions, has begun taking entries for the 2009 Dossier Fleet Maintenance Software calendar photo contest.

The second annual event is the only contest of its kind in the industry.


“Our 2008 calendar was a runaway success. We featured 12 Dossier customer fleets, one for each month, and distributed over 5,000 copies of the calendar. We’re looking forward to even greater participation for 2009,” said Bob Hausler, Arsenault Associates vice-president of marketing and technology.

According to Bob Hausler, Arsenault Associates VP of marketing and technology, the 2008 Dossier calendar featured full color photographs of fleet maintenance subjects — individual vehicles, fleet portraits, and maintenance facilities. Along with a photo (in some cases more than one), each month included a brief description of how that fleet used Dossier to its best advantage.

The 2009 Dossier calendar will follow the same format. The contest is open to all Dossier users in any industry operation such as trucking, construction, bus, government, waste handling, and utility. Specific contest rules and information is provided on the entry form. The deadline for entries is midnight, Aug. 15.

Hausler said each contestant must:

  • Submit one (or more) digital photo(s) of their fleet, shop, fuel island, or anything of interest to other fleet managers.

  • Include a brief statement about how they use Dossier fleet maintenance software to better control their fleet. Some examples include fuel savings, reduced costs and downtime, or lower parts inventories.

Twelve winners will be selected based on the interest quality of their photo and their user statement. In addition to being displayed on the calendar, each of the 12 winners will receive a special Dossier prize selected exclusively for them. One entry will also be chosen as the Grand Prize Winner as the best fleet photo or statement for 2009 and receive a Grand Prize award andspecial placement in the calendar. All contest participants will receive a Dossier logo gift items.

The 12 contest winners will be announced by October 2008. The 2009 Dossier calendars will be available shortly thereafter.
